Output 8525758be1c6315477fd5466f0da250b5c3c3f0d3c3ffd154d8c9218f8ed88f6:0

value
202334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0580aa7bcdc6dca1ff136548ca87db9228073e3a OP_EQUAL
address
32C7SNQmBvHj8iVW1ou8Lj3w7YGP7NmFnA
transaction
8525758be1c6315477fd5466f0da250b5c3c3f0d3c3ffd154d8c9218f8ed88f6
spent
true